Hello, everybody!
Trying to update AXX4DRV3GEXP backplane's firmware from version 2.17 to either 2.18 or 2.14 I get the folloving error from FWPIAUPD utility (as in the attached file):
ERROR 005: Update failure. [.\fwpiaupd.cpp line 371]
ERROR 007: Invalid input file for this platform. [.\fwpiaupd.cpp line 1687]
A brief history. I've successfully updated BIOS / BMC / FRUSDR / ME firmware to versions 60 / 0.58 / 30 / 1.12.0070, then updated AXX6DRV3GEXP backplane's firmware to v. 2.18, also successfully. The followed update of AXX4DRV3GEXP failed with the error mentioned above.
After some search in these discussions I've found and followed all the recomendations from Aryan2411, I believe, as well as tried to use ipmi.efi and fwpiaupd.efi from his "Everything is explained clearly.zip" file (the last with program error which sounds like "the file is not a valid image"). All with the same result.

Here are the server components:
Chassis SC5600LX
Mainboard S5500HCVR ( BIOS / BMC / FRUSDR / ME F/W v.v. 60 / 0.58 / 30 / 1.12.0070)
CPU Xeon BX80614E5620 (2 pcs)
RAM KVR1333D3D4R9S/4G (6 pcs)
HDD WD1002FAEX (3 pcs)
Backplane AXX6DRV3GEXP (F/W v. 2.18)
Backplane AXX4DRV3GEXP (F/W v. 2.17)
RAID enabling switch AXXRAKSW5
Remote management module AXXRMM3
ESRT II AXX4SASMOD
CPU Heatsink FXXRGTHSINK (2 pcs)
ODD Optiarc AD-5260S-0B

Do you have IPMB cables connected to both backplanes? Try to remove the AXX6DRV3GEXP temporarily, and connect the AXX4DRV3GEXP to the primary IPMB port (HSBP_A) and update the FW.
Note: When connecting both backplanes, connect the 6-drive backplane to HSBP_A, and the 4-drive backplane to HSBP_B.
